Minolta Pocket Autopak 230
The 200 with the Pocket Flash 25 attached |
The Autopak 230 was the 'rest of the world' version of the Bicentennial Autopak 200.
It has all the characteristics of the 200 without the Stars and Stripes and with a yellow shutter button rather than a blue one.
Minolta released two versions of the Pocket Flash 25 to take account of the 200 and 230.
